rematch
1. noun /riːˈmætʃ,ˈriː.mætʃ/
A repeated contest staged between the same opponents or teams which played a previous contest.

After being beaten in pool by Melanie, Mohner asked for a rematch.

2. verb /riːˈmætʃ,ˈriː.mætʃ/
a) To bring opponents together for such a contest.

We had to rematch the mixed-up parts.

b) To stage such a contest.
